    Quote Originally Posted by kingy View Post
    what exactly are you downloading from them? can't i just change my dns and get access?
    if you mean can you just change your DNS to something random and get access to US sites, then no you can't. You have to point your DNS to their servers.

    If you are asking if you need to download something from them or simply point your DNS entry to their servers, then the answer is no you don't download anything, you just register for the trial with your email and input the DNS servers and you're done. A week later they will send you an email saying your trial is over and the sites will no longer work. So you can either sign up for 4.99/month to keep it working, or point your DNS servers back to rogers/bell/opendns or whoever else you use.
